80 Tesla vehicles damaged at an Ontario city dealership [Video]

Police are investigating after multiple Tesla vehicles were damaged at an Ontario dealership.

Today, Hamilton police said that on March 19, officers were called to the Tesla dealership at 999 Upper Wentworth Street on Hamilton Mountain to respond to reports that several vehicles had been damaged.

Police allege that upwards of 80 vehicles that were parked outdoors were found with some degree of damage, including deep scratch marks and punctured tires.

While police did not ascribe a possible motive to the suspected mischief, Tesla vehicles have been targeted in recent months in response to owner Elon Musk’s involvement in the Donald Trump administration.

Musk has quickly become a polarizing figure in the United States and abroad in recent years but has faced more extensive criticism for cutting a significant number of public sector jobs through his government agency DOGE.
